Course Curriculum Overview

4.5

Course curriculum was quite good in comparison to other colleges as our professors were highly qualified and they know till which extent they have to go to make us understand the things. They used to give us the industry related examples by comparing that with normal life which was very easy for us to grab. The labs were highly developed with latest technology machines. These examples helped me a lot during my campus placement. They even made us go for an internship to any of the industries. Professionals took us for an industrial trip to aluminium manufacturing industry where we can see how it was extracted tilll the finished products. Doubts were solved in no time. They made us feel friendly towards our subjects.

Placement Experience

3

Placement was not that good. For mechanical and civil all the companies they brought were startups, some came to be fraud as no existence, some came to be treating differently. For other trades the campus were quite good. For my course the company visited are Friction Elements, Reliance, Lintech, etc. Placement teams have a target that any how all has to be placed but it doesn't matter to them what type of company it is. They used to take one month salary for that particular company and only after that they give the offer letter. For developing the skills they conduct many seminars for the interview and skill building.

Hostel Facilities

4.5

Yes I opted for hostel. The rooms were good and the number of occupants were only 3. All hostels are wifi enabled. Food was very nice. They used to charge 50000 for the hostel. Food given was 3 times which were included in 50000, but evening snacks were extra paid.

Admission

I got the admission after giving OJEE entrance exam and after that I booked seats in this college after going through the fees structure. I opted this college as the fees was quite ok. Then after booking the seats I went for nodal centre to have my certificate, marks verified and to finalize the college. After that there was two rounds for your trade selection. In first round I got civil as my trade and in final round I got mechanical. So I chose mechanical as it was the final and awaited for the admission date. Paying fees was quite good as they allowed to pay in installments. This was the full process.

Faculty

4.5

Total number of lecturers for my course were 20. Each of them were highly qualified in there prospective. Some were PhD holders, some with Mtech, some with highly industrial experience, and one was IITian. The age of the lecturers were not that old only leaving 2-3 all were mostly around 35-40 years.
